
Every year on December 10, HUMAN RIGHTS DAY celebration is done to raise awareness of universally recognized human rights. It is commemorated to raise and promote the freedoms and rights outlined in the 1948 Universal Declaration of Human Rights, which was adopted by the UN General Assembly.
The Universal Declaration of Human Rights was ratified by the UN General Assembly on December 10, 1948, and that day is recognized as Human Rights Day. The fundamental rights of every person, which must be uniformly respected, are outlined in this constitution. A key document in the development of human rights is the Universal Declaration of Human Rights (UDHR).
The 74th anniversary of the Universal Declaration of Human Rights will be celebrated this year. According to the universal principle of human rights, everyone deserves to be treated fairly and with respect. The accomplishment of those who fought for human rights is honored on this day. Numerous seminars, webinars, cultural activities, and exhibitions take place all around the world on this day.
The statement and WHO’s Constitution state that health is a fundamental human right for all people, and “Dignity, Freedom, and Justice For All,” is the topic for Human Rights Day 2022.
